IMF mission arrives in Pakistan for $8.4bn loan reviews amid flood crisis

September 26, 2025 (MLN): An International Monetary Fund (IMF) mission has arrived in Pakistan to conduct crucial reviews of the country’s ongoing bailout and climate financing programs, the lender confirmed on Thursday.

The delegation will hold the second review of the $7 billion Extended Fund Facility (EFF) and the first review of the $1.4bn Resilience and Sustainability Facility (RSF), both vital for Pakistan’s economic stability and climate resilience.

The IMF approved the $7bn bailout package under its EFF program in September 2024 to support Pakistan’s struggling economy.

In May 2025, the global lender sanctioned an additional $1.4bn RSF loan to help Pakistan build resilience against climate change impacts and natural disasters.

The mission’s arrival follows a high-profile meeting between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if and IMF Managing Director Kristalina Georgieva in New York on the sidelines of the United Nations General Assembly session.

Sharif reiterated Pakistan’s commitment to IMF targets but urged the Fund to consider the economic fallout of recent floods in its upcoming review.

“[The IMF mission will] hold discussions on the second review under the Extended Fund Facility and the first review of the Resilience and Sustainability Facility,” said Mahir Binici, IMF’s Resident Representative in Pakistan, while speaking to Arab News.

So far, Pakistan has received over $2bn disbursements under the EFF and is eyeing a third tranche of $1bn, contingent on the successful completion of the ongoing review.
